The National Rice Festival takes place in Crowley, Louisiana, in October 1938. This annual event celebrates the rice industry, which plays a crucial role in the local economy. The festival includes parades, cooking contests, and cultural exhibitions, drawing attention to the importance of rice production in Louisianas agricultural landscape.
